Consulate offers to arrange air travel for american citizens wanting to evacuate from Eastern saudi  racing to find wily scud launchers by David Lauter and Karen Tumulty los Angeles times Washington in the skies Over Iraq a deadly Chase is being played out a race pitting americans highest technology a from spy satellites to laser guided bombs a against iraqi missile Crews desperate to stay alive and protect Saddam Hussein a most fearsome weapon. At stake Are the lives of Allied troops the safety of thousands of israeli civilians and the survival of the fragile but persistent Western Arab coalition that upholds the current War Effort. The Hunt for iraqis Mobile scud missile launchers a what president Bush Calls a the darn est search and de stroy Effort that a Ever been undertaken a is a was difficult As any military Mission there is a said David och Manek a leading . Military analyst. A suppose you were told to. Find three dozen trucks somewhere in the state of Wyoming and the owner of those trucks was determined to hide them. I think that gives you an idea of the difficulty a said Ochmanek a senior staff member Tif the Rand corp. The commander of Allied forces in the persian Gulf was typically Blunt in assessing the difficulty of the Mission. A finding the Mobile launchers is like finding a Needle in a Haystack a said Gen. H. Norman Schwarzkopf. But As difficult As the Mission is it is also essential. Unless an actual ground assault against iraqi troops begins the scuds a armed with conventional explosives or possibly deadly nerve Gas a Are the Only iraqi weapon that can pose a credible direct threat to american troops. A perhaps even More important for the future of the .-led Effort against Iraq the scuds a As Saddam demonstrated thursday and Friday nights a can be used against civilian targets in Israel. . Experts and analysts disagree Over whether the iraqis Are Able to Load a chemical warhead onto a scud and fire it the roughly 300 Miles Between Western Iraq and Israel. A Over the next few Days i have Confidence that the United states can find these missiles and destroy them a said Jeffrey Shaffer a military analyst at the Washington based Center for International and strategic studies. A it s a matter of racing the  the . Entries in that race Are some of the country a most sophisticated weapons a f-15, t-16 and f-111 fighter bombers loaded with Cluster bombs a As Well As sensitive radars observation satellites communications spy satellites and infrared sensors according to military officials and defense Industry experts. Their Quarry soviet made launch vehicles designed specifically for the 5u0 to 800 scud missiles believed to be in Iraq s inventory Are essentially specialized trucks about the size of a semitrailer Reg t he vehicles can be driven along highways at 20 to 30 Mph and hidden in aircraft hangers Small factories warehouses even under Highway Bridges or among Trees on Date Palm plantations. . Officials said at least 11 Mobile launchers have been destroyed so far. In briefings analysts said Iraq was believed to have 30 to 40 launchers when the War began. In the past however some analysts had estimated that Iraq possessed As Many As 70 launchers. All of those under attack were in what the Pentagon Calls the a Kuwait theater of operations a Kuwait acid. Southern Iraq Schwarzkopf said at a briefing in riyadh., Mobile missiles in Western Iraq a the ones used to attack Israel a apparently were not tracked Down by Friday evening. The race to track and destroy Mobile missile launchers often comes Down to a  minutes said John Pike a weapons expert at the federation of american scientists. Once the fiery plume of a missile lifting off its platform announces the position of a launcher even a Well trained iraqi Crew would need about 15 minutes to dismantle its Rig and drive to a new  that time . Planes based in saudi Arabia flying at speeds of 1,000 Mph could easily be on top of a target in or around Kuwait Pike said.
